Rotundene

Taxonomy Hydrocarbons > Unsaturated hydrocarbons > Branched unsaturated hydrocarbons
IUPAC Name 1,5,9-trimethyltricyclo[6.2.2.02,6]dodec-9-ene

Physical and Chemical Properties

Top
Molecular Formula C15H24
Molecular Weight 204.35 g/mol
Exact Mass 204.187800766 g/mol
Topological Polar Surface Area (TPSA) 0.00 Ų
XlogP 5.00
Atomic LogP (AlogP) 4.42
H-Bond Acceptor 0
H-Bond Donor 0
Rotatable Bonds 0

Plants that contains it

Top
Below are displayed all the plants proven (via scientific papers) to contain this compound!
To see more specific details click the taxa you are interested in.
Cyperus alopecuroides
Cyperus rotundus
